    Abstract: System and methods including a set of mathematical manipulatives that are designed to demonstrate the properties of logarithms and exponents are provided. A system that facilitates instruction in the logarithms, the system includes a set of manipulatives including at least one manipulative, each manipulative having a length proportional to a logarithm of a number labeled on the manipulative, the set of manipulatives are positionable end to end; and a measurement tool having markings for measuring a plurality of multiples of at least one manipulative; wherein, when one or more manipulatives are positioned end to end, a product of the numbers labeled on the manipulatives positioned end to end equals the number on a manipulative that has the same length as a total length of manipulatives positioned end to end.

    Abstract: Artificial Intelligence-assisted building/execution of federated data layer for enterprise engineering: A system trains at least one machine-learning model to identify information about industrial assets from training data, then map the information to a federated data model. The system retrieves information about data from an application in an industrial asset. The at least one machine-learning model identifies types of the data, relationships between the data, and patterns of the data, from the information and based on data types, data relationships, and data patterns in the federated data model. The at least one machine-learning model maps the types of the data, the relationships between the data, and the patterns of the data to the federated data model. The system identifies knowledge about the types of the data, the relationships between the data, and/or the patterns of the data in the federated data model, in response to a query about data.

    Abstract: Embodiments of an integrated circuit are described. This integrated circuit may include a Universal Data Bus Serializer. Moreover, the Universal Data Bus Serializer may include: an input to receive data for transmission over a data bus of a vehicle; memory storing a plurality of protocol operating instructions, where each protocol operating instruction corresponds to a given operating protocol; a selection unit, coupled to the input and the memory, that chooses one of the plurality of protocol operating instructions based on a given protocol; and a serial data output to couple to the data bus and to output serial data based at least in part on the given protocol.

    Abstract: A method for expediting manufacture of replacement gaskets. A specialized scale is used to allow for rapid, accurate measurement of a gasket, or flange rubbing, remote from the gasket manufacturer. These measurements may then be imported into design software by the manufacturer to facilitate the production of replacement gaskets.

    Abstract: A method for configuring the airflow direction through a chassis having electronic components installed therein. The method may include: powering on at least a first power supply unit installed within the chassis; determining an airflow direction of the first power supply unit may include one or more unidirectional fans; configuring the airflow direction through the chassis to be the airflow direction of the first power supply unit to create a first configured airflow direction; determining an airflow direction of a first fan tray installed within the chassis, the first fan tray may include one or more unidirectional fans; and conducting a conflict check between the first configured airflow direction and the airflow direction of the first fan tray to determine if the airflow directions are substantially the same.

    Abstract: Methods, systems, apparatuses, and devices are described for continuity of a wireless serial bus (WSB) service across multiple WSB service sessions. A host may perform a discovery process with a device as part of WSB service session establishment. The host may determine an identifier that is unique to the WSB service provided during the first WSB service session and send the unique identifier to the device. If the WSB service session is terminated, the host may establish a second WSB service session with the device using the unique identifier and without performing another discovery process with the device. The WSB service may support universal serial bus (USB) over Wi-Fi services.

    Abstract: A multistable liquid crystal device having liquid crystal molecules in one or more cavities, wherein at least one liquid crystal region of high distortion (100, 110) is formed in each cavity, the distortion region (100, 110) being switchable between at least two stable states on application of an electric field, the device being such that at least one of the stable states may be utilized as a reflective mode.

    Abstract: Apparatus, systems and methods for alignment of a glass member for high temperature processing are disclosed. The high temperature processing can, for example, pertain to a slumping process to mold glass into a predetermined shape (e.g., a three-dimensional shape). In one embodiment, a glass slumping system can have a mold and an alignment system that support a glass member to be slumped relative to the mold. The alignment system may have a plurality of alignment members being configured to move away from the glass member as the temperature increases during the slumping process to allow the glass member to bend around the mold without interference.

    Abstract: A method and computer system are described for conducting commercial transactions. An enhanced type of XML schema may be used which supports integrity constraints and polymorphism. Schemas are identified by the use of Uniform Resource Names. XML processors residing on transaction servers or trading partner servers parse document instances by retrieving the URNs corresponding to the schemas used to interpret the document. The URNs are converted to location-dependent URIs in order to locate the schemas. URNs are resolved to location-dependent URIs by use of the LDAP protocol. URNs may be converted to LDAP URLs which are used to search LDAP compliant directories. The directories serve as registries for the URI values corresponding to the URNs.

    Abstract: Access is obtained to a plurality of information flow theories for a plurality of malicious programs. The information flow theories include differences in information flows between the malicious programs, executing in a controlled environment, and information flows of known benign programs. Execution of a suspicious program is monitored by comparing runtime behavior of the suspicious program to the plurality of information flow theories. An alarm is output if the runtime behavior of the suspicious program matches at least one of the plurality of information flow theories.

    Abstract: A method and an apparatus for shaping an edge at a juncture of two adjoining surfaces of a part. A first surface and a second surface of the part are abraded by contacting a polishing surface of a polishing wheel to the first surface and to the second surface. The polishing surface spins in opposite rotational directions about an axis parallel to the edge when contacting the first and second surfaces respectively. The polishing surface moves at different translational speeds and the polishing wheel spins at different rotational speeds along straight segments and along curved segments of the edge. The shaped edge has a visually smooth and geometrically uniform appearance.

    Abstract: Apparatus, systems and methods for forming complex edges on a glass member through the use of a glass slumping process are disclosed. According to one aspect of the invention, a method of forming a complex edge in a glass forming process includes grinding an edge of a glass member and polishing the edge of the glass member. Grinding the edge of the glass member causes the edge of the glass member to have a first level of complexity. The method also includes performing a slumping process on the glass member. Performing the slumping process causes the edge of the glass member to have a second level of complexity that is more complex than the first level of complexity.

    Abstract: Methods and systems for accurately determining dimensional accuracy of a complex three dimensional shape are disclosed. The invention in one respect includes determining at least a non-critical feature and at least a critical feature of the 3-D component, determining a first datum using at least the non-critical feature, aligning the first datum to at least a portion of a reference shape, determining a second datum corresponding to the critical feature subsequent to the aligning, and determining the dimensional accuracy of the 3-D component by comparing the second datum to another portion of the reference shape.
